Airbnb, Inc. vs Unilever plc — how do they compare? Airbnb, Inc. trades at $142.86 (market cap $88.31B), while Unilever plc trades at $62.07 (market cap $133.28B). The key difference: Unilever plc is the larger of the two by market cap, and Unilever plc pays a 3.63% dividend while Airbnb, Inc. pays none. Which is the better fit depends on your goals.

Airbnb, Inc.

Airbnb (ABNB) trades at $148.80, showing minimal daily movement with a slight decline of 0.09%. The stock maintains a bullish technical outlook with strong moving average signals and trades near pivot point resistance at $149. Fundamentally, the company demonstrates robust profitability with 82.9% gross margins and 19.9% net income margin, though recent quarters have seen earnings misses against expectations. Revenue growth continues with 2025 reaching $12.24 billion, supported by the company's asset-light model and global travel recovery.

The investment case balances strong fundamentals against valuation concerns, with a P/E of 36.5 suggesting premium pricing. Analyst consensus remains positive with a $161.80 price target, though recent earnings misses and CEO stock sales warrant monitoring. Key risks include travel demand sensitivity, competitive pressures, and execution of new initiatives like hotel expansion and AI development. The stock offers growth exposure to travel recovery but requires careful valuation assessment.

Unilever plc

Unilever (UL) trades at $62.74, up 0.42% today, with a bullish technical signal from moving averages. Recent earnings misses contrast with strong profitability margins and a 53.32% ROE. The company is actively reshaping its portfolio through deals like the proposed McCormick food business combination and a $270 million innovation center investment, signaling strategic growth initiatives amid mixed quarterly performance.

UL presents a balanced risk-reward with fair valuation metrics, but faces execution risks from recent earnings shortfalls and portfolio transitions. The analyst community is divided, with a slim majority recommending Hold. Investors should weigh strong cash flow generation against competitive pressures in consumer goods markets.

About Airbnb, Inc.

Airbnb, Inc. operates an online marketplace for travel information and booking services. The Company offers lodging, home stay, and tourism services via websites and mobile applications. Airbnb serves clients worldwide.

About Unilever plc

Unilever is a diversified personal product (42% of 2021 sales by value), home care (20%), and packaged food (38%) company. Its brands include Knorr soups and sauces, Hellmann's mayonnaise, Lipton teas, Axe and Dove skin products, and the TRESemme haircare brand. The firm has been acquisitive in recent years
